Although largely anticipated, the Ravens officially franchise tagged OLB Matthew Judon.

The Ravens will now have until July 15th to finalize a new deal with Judon. If a deal cannot be reached, Judon would play all of 2020 under the franchise tag. 

The franchise tag value for linebackers is projected to be worth $16.26 million. 

Judon, 27, led the team with 9.5 sacks, 18 tackles for loss, and 33 quarterback hits. Extending Judon long-term would be ideal for Baltimore, as he's clearly their best pass rusher. 

Additional rumors link a possible trade involving Judon, in order to get compensation for the star edge rusher. 

Head coach John Harbaugh has praised Judon's as an "anchor" of the Ravens defense.

“He’s proven who he is as a football player,” Harbaugh said. “He’s established himself as one of the top outside linebacker, pass-rusher, edge-setters in the National Football League right now, which was his goal to do. He’s done it, and I’m proud of him.”

Judon mentioned earlier this offseason his love for Baltimore. “I love this organization, it’s the only organization I’ve played for. I’m comfortable here; I have family here; I already know the house I’m going to get if I sign [laughter>. But that’s up to upstairs.”
